Royal Winnipeg & 1st Canadian Scottish Memorial

This double memorial has a plaque to the Rifles on the left and to the Scottish on the right. Between them is a poem by Paul Eluard. In front is a board describing the liberation of the village (Putot-en-Bessin) and the casualties, including 98 Germans & 256 Canadians, of whom 45 were massacred at Audrieu Chateau. Date: 2009
